Effect of robot operation by a camera with the eye tracking control

Masahiko Minamoto, Yutaro Suzuki, Takahiro Kanno, Kenji Kawashima

In this paper, we develop a control system for tele-operation of robots using an eye tracking control and confirm its effectiveness by experiments. A camera mounted on the robot provides a view to an operator via a monitor screen. The screen is divided into 3×3 grids. The robot stops when the gaze is on the center grid cell. When the gaze is on the other gird cells, the robot moves to the direction with a pre-defined constant speed. We apply the developed system to control a laparoscope holder robot and a crawler-type rescue robot. In the laparoscope holder robot, no sensor needs to be attached on the operator with the system while a gyroscope is mounted on the conventional system. In the tele-operation of the rescue robot, the control system is used to view the robot from an operation room. The travel time of a narrow pilot road becomes shorter in the proposed control system than the verbal instruction to the camera operator.
